description Based on a Web service quality model, this paper proposes a Web services automatic composition approach that can enable end user to compose a Web service automatically. After modeling Web services with rules and eliminating semantics conflicts among model parameters, a deduced network is computed with the inputs given by end user. With the deduced network, we can find the composition plan whose QoS is optimal
